The Role of a Medical Assistant<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"medicalThe function of a medical assistant can be diverse as well as challenging. Essentially their duty is to make sure that the Grand Isle VT clinics, hospitals and other medical care institutions where they work operate efficiently. Depending on the size or type of facility, they can be more of a clinical assistant, an administrative assistant, or in smaller facilities both. They are tasked with giving direct assistance to the physicians, nurses and other medical professionals but can also be found working at the front desk or in an office.
